Mango Delight Truffle Ingredients
For the Truffles
- Mango Purée – Use ripe mangoes like Alphonso or Ataulfo for an irresistibly sweet base.
- Desiccated Coconut – This ingredient adds chewiness and a tropical flair; don’t forget extra for rolling!
- Sweetened Condensed Milk – It binds everything together, giving the truffles a rich, fudgy texture.
For the Coating
- Additional Desiccated Coconut – Rolling the truffles enhances their appearance and boosts coconut flavor.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Mango Delight Truffles
Step 1: Prepare the Mango Purée
Begin by scooping the pulp from 2 ripe mangoes, ensuring to use sweet varieties like Alphonso or Ataulfo. Blend the pulp in a food processor until you achieve a smooth purée, aiming for about 1 cup. This vibrant mango purée serves as the heart of your Mango Delight Truffles, infusing them with natural sweetness.
Step 2: Toast the Coconut
In a nonstick pan, add 1 cup of desiccated coconut and toast it over low heat for about 1 minute. Keep stirring continuously to prevent burning and enhance its flavor. The coconut should turn a warm, golden color, signaling that it’s ready to blend with the other ingredients for your truffles.
Step 3: Cook the Mixture
Now it’s time to combine your ingredients! In the same pan, add the mango purée you made earlier along with 1 can of sweetened condensed milk. Stir this mixture over medium heat for 5–7 minutes until it thickens and resembles soft dough, pulling away from the pan’s sides, which indicates your Mango Delight Truffles filling is ready.
Step 4: Shape the Truffles
After the mixture cools slightly, prepare to shape your truffles. Scoop out 1 tablespoon portions of the thickened mixture and roll them gently between your palms to form smooth balls. This step is crucial for ensuring each delightful mango truffle is perfectly sized and ready for the next step.
Step 5: Coat & Store
Roll each ball in the extra desiccated coconut until fully coated, giving them an appealing finish. Once coated, place the truffles in an airtight container. Chill them in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es to set. Your Mango Delight Truffles are now ready to be enjoyed, offering a delightful bite of tropical bliss!

Tips for the Best Mango Delight Truffles
-
Select Ripe Mangoes: Ensure your mangoes are very ripe for a sweeter, smoother purée. This is key to achieving the best Mango Delight Truffles!
-
Avoid Sticky Mixture: If the mixture becomes too sticky when shaping, consider chilling it briefly or lightly greasing your hands for easier handling.
-
Flavor Boost: For an extra layer of taste, try adding a pinch of cardamom or a splash of vanilla extract to the mixture.
-
Coconut Toasting: Toasting the desiccated coconut enhances its flavor; keep a close eye as it can burn quickly!
-
Storage Tips: Keep your truffles in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week to maintain freshness and chewiness.

How to Store and Freeze Mango Delight Truffles
Fridge: Store your Mango Delight Truffles in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week. This will keep them fresh and delicious for your sweet cravings!
Freezer: If you want to enjoy them for longer, freeze the truffles in a single layer on a baking sheet. Once solid, transfer to a freezer-safe bag and they will last up to 2 months.
Thawing: To indulge in frozen truffles, simply take them out and let them thaw in the fridge for about 30 minutes before serving, ensuring optimal flavor and texture.
Reheating: These truffles are best enjoyed chilled. However, if you’d like to enhance the flavors, allow them to sit at room temperature for about 10 minutes before savoring.

Mango Delight Truffles Recipe FAQs
What type of mangoes should I use for the best truffles?
To ensure your Mango Delight Truffles are bursting with flavor, opt for very ripe mangoes such as Alphonso or Ataulfo. Their natural sweetness and smooth texture make them the ideal choice for a creamy, luscious mango purée, which is the heart of the truffles.
How long can I store these truffles?
You can keep your Mango Delight Truffles in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week. This storage method helps maintain their chewy texture and refreshing flavor, making them perfect for sweet cravings throughout the week.
Can I freeze Mango Delight Truffles?
Absolutely! To freeze your truffles, lay them out in a single layer on a baking sheet, and place them in the freezer until solid. Then, transfer them to a freezer-safe bag where they will keep well for up to 2 months. Just remember to let them thaw in the fridge for about 30 minutes before serving for the best texture and flavor.
What if the mixture is too sticky when shaping?
If you find the truffle mixture sticking to your hands while shaping, there are a couple of fixes. First, you can lightly grease your hands with a bit of coconut oil to make rolling easier. Alternatively, pop the mixture in the fridge for 10-15 minutes to chill it slightly, which will help firm it up and make it more manageable to shape.
Are these truffles suitable for people with allergies?
These Mango Delight Truffles are naturally gluten-free, making them suitable for those with gluten sensitivity. However, do keep in mind that they contain coconut and sweetened condensed milk, so if you or your guests have allergies to dairy or nuts (especially if you decide to add nuts for crunch), it’s best to check or find alternatives! Always ensure to read labels carefully for potential allergens.
